# This script is meant to be run once after running start for the first # time. This script downloads a cirros image and registers it. Then it # configures nova networking and nova quotas to allow 40 m1.small instances #to be created. # Move to top level directory REAL_PATH=$(python -c "import os,sys;print os.path.realpath('$0')") cd "$(dirname "$REAL_PATH")/.." # Test for credentials set if [[ "${OS_USERNAME}" == "" ]]; then echo "No Keystone credentials specified. Try running source openrc" exit fi # Test to ensure configure script is run only once if [[ `glance image-list | grep cirros | wc -l` -gt 0 ]]; then echo "This tool should only be run once per deployment." exit fi echo Downloading glance image. IMAGE_URL=http://download.cirros-cloud.net/0.3.3/ IMAGE=cirros-0.3.3-x86_64-disk.img if ! [ -f "$IMAGE" ]; then curl -L -o ./$IMAGE $IMAGE_URL/$IMAGE fi echo Creating glance image. glance image-create --name cirros --is-public false --disk-format qcow2 --container-format bare --file ./$IMAGE echo Configuring nova networking. nova secgroup-add-rule default tcp 22 22 0.0.0.0/0 nova secgroup-add-rule default icmp -1 -1 0.0.0.0/0 nova network-create vmnet --fixed-range-v4=10.0.0.0/24 --bridge=br100 --multi-host=T echo Configuring nova public key and quotas. nova keypair-add --pub-key ~/.ssh/id_rsa.pub mykey # Increase the quota to allow 40 m1.small instances to be created # Get admin user and tenant IDs ADMIN_USER=$(keystone user-list | awk '/admin/ {print $2'}) ADMIN_TENANT=$(keystone tenant-list | awk '/admin/ {print $2}') # 40 instances nova quota-update --instances 40 $ADMIN_TENANT nova quota-update --user $ADMIN_USER --instances 40 $ADMIN_TENANT # 40 cores nova quota-update --cores 40 $ADMIN_TENANT nova quota-update --user $ADMIN_USER --cores 40 $ADMIN_TENANT # 96GB ram nova quota-update --ram 96000 $ADMIN_TENANT nova quota-update --user $ADMIN_USER --ram 96000 $ADMIN_TENANT
